Checking the Subrack Power-on
Check the connection between the core end terminal of the power cable and the corresponding output terminal of
the power distribution box. Check if all power connectors are connected tightly. If not, use the flat-head screwdriver
to tighten the captive screws on the connectors of power cables.
Check the connection of the other end (with OT naked crimping connector) of the power cable with the PIU board.
Each subrack must be provided with two lines of power supply.
Turn on the power switch of the part A on the DC power distribution box for each subrack. Check if the subrack are
powered on. If powered on, go on turning on the power switch of the part B and then turn off the power switch of
the part A. Check if the subrack are powered on. If powered on, turn on the power switch of the part A.
Check the cabinet power indicator at the top of the cabinet. The green indicator stays on.
When the subrack is powered on, the fan starts to operate. Check the air ventilation at the top and the bottom of
the subrack.
Observe the STATE indicator on the front panel of the fan. Normally, it is always green.
If the STATE indicator is constantly red, it indicates that two or more fans are faulty.
If the STATE indicator is constantly yellow, it indicates that one fan is faulty.
WARNING
Do not insert or remove power plugs and the PIU when the power is on.
